Abstract
There is disclosed various terpene based cleansing formulations for skin. The cleaning formulations include the ingredients of water in which there is dispersed a terpene, nonionic surfactants, corn meal scrubber and preservatives including antimicrobial and antioxidant agents. In one aspect of the invention the skin cleansing formulations include orange terpenes as the solvent. The nonionic surfactants present in the formulation provide stabilization of the terpene/water mixture, do not soften or otherwise attack the corn meal, and provide detergency for suspending the lifted soil.
